Mesothelioma Claim - How to File a Mesothelioma Claim
A mesothelioma claim can provide compensation for financial losses related to asbestos exposure. Patients and their families need funds to pay for the cost of treatment and replace lost income.
Many asbestos companies declared bankruptcy and established trust funds to pay victims. An experienced mesothelioma lawyer can determine if you are eligible to file a mesothelioma trust fund claim.
Compensation
Compensation for mesothelioma may aid patients and their families with medical expenses as well as caregiving costs and other expenses. Compensation is granted through a combination asbestos trust funds, trial verdicts, and settlements. The total amount of mesothelioma compensation is determined by the particular circumstances of each case.

Veterans' benefits
Many veterans diagnosed with mesothelioma and other asbestos-related illnesses may be eligible for compensation. This could include monthly disability payments, medical treatment and travel expenses to mesothelioma treatment facilities.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ist veterans to determine which VA claim and compensation options are best for their particular situation. The type of cancer that a veteran is diagnosed with, as well as their income level may affect the benefits they are eligible for.
Veterans suffering from mesothelioma or other diseases related to asbestos can take advantage of various VA programs. These include pension, disability compensation, and travel benefits. Disability compensation is a tax-free monthly benefit that is determined by the severity of a veterans mesothelioma-related diagnosis and related disabilities due to service. Veterans with mesothelioma diagnosis who have an absolute disability rating and higher will generally receive the maximum monthly amount of compensation.
Veterans with mesothelioma that have disabilities that are connected to their service are eligible to receive treatment for free at the West Los Angeles VA Medical Center. Additionally the VA offers accommodation and transportation to and from the mesothelioma specialist. Certain veterans have taken advantage of these free mesothelioma treatments, and have increased their lifespans and quality of life.
Certain veterans might be eligible for Aid and Attendance or a housebound benefit. This benefit can help a veteran pay for a caregiver should they require assistance with activities of daily living, like bathing, eating and dressing. Certain veterans have an advanced stage diagnosis and are in bed. This benefit may be used to pay for an assistant to nursing or a home health aide.
